A former chief U.S. nuclear regulator asserted Tuesday that the massive volumes of tritium-tainted water stored at the Fukushima No. 1 nuclear plant can be ¡°safely¡± dumped into the sea after it is diluted to reduce the levels of radioactive tritium below the legal limit.
¡°Most people don¡¯t know what tritium is, so what they will think about is that it¡¯s bad, something that¡¯s really dangerous. But tritium is an element that we know a lot about,¡± Dale Klein, chairman of Tokyo Electric Power Co.¡¯s Nuclear Reform Monitoring Committee, told a news conference in Tokyo.
¡°It can be released safely into the ocean. We know worldwide what the safe limit for tritium release is,¡± said Klein, who once headed the U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ission.
